What the hell?
Apparently US Customs and Border Patrol agents are enforcing an old law that prohibits importing lottery tickets into the USA. You can buy them, but you can't come back to Canada, and return to the USA with them: CTV Vancouver: Border guards' Powerball warning | CTV Vancouver News
Here's the law (referenced, but not explained in the video.) https://www.law.cornell.edu/uscode/text/19/1305
19 U.S. Code § 1305 - Immoral articles; importation prohibited
(a) Prohibition of importation
All persons are prohibited from importing into the United States from any foreign country any book, pamphlet, paper, writing, advertisement, circular, print, picture, or drawing containing any matter advocating or urging treason or insurrection against the United States, or forcible resistance to any law of the United States, or containing any threat to take the life of or inflict bodily harm upon any person in the United States, or any obscene book, pamphlet, paper, writing, advertisement, circular, print, picture, drawing, or other representation, figure, or image on or of paper or other material, or any cast, instrument, or other article which is obscene or immoral, or any drug or medicine or any article whatever for causing unlawful abortion, or any lottery ticket, or any printed paper that may be used as a lottery ticket, or any advertisement of any lottery. No such articles whether imported separately or contained in packages with other goods entitled to entry, shall be admitted to entry; and all such articles and, unless it appears to the satisfaction of the appropriate customs officer that the obscene or other prohibited articles contained in the package were inclosed therein without the knowledge or consent of the importer, owner, agent, or consignee, the entire contents of the package in which such articles are contained, shall be subject to seizure and forfeiture as hereinafter provided:
You can't even cross the border with a Lotto Max ticket in your wallet. Google newspaper archives reference a couple articles where 6/49 tickets were seized in the 80's by customs when Americans went across the border to Ontario to buy 6/49 tickets.

Or rent yourself a mailbox in Blaine and stash it there... leave it with a "trusted" friend... bury it in a box along 0 Ave.... | Yeah. Importing in this case just means bringing it into the USA. Doesn't matter the origin. Stupid Prohibition era law, but now the application of it seems to be to prevent foreign lottery scams from entering the US.
If you had the 1.4 billion dollar winning ticket shoved down your pants, you're probably going to be nervous enough to get made by CBP and end up strip searched.
The CTV bit suggested leaving the tickets in the US too.
